在电商网站开发领域,MVC(Model-View-Controller)框架因其结构清晰、易于维护和扩展等优点,被广泛采用。本文将为你详细介绍MVC框架的入门知识,并提供一些实战资源,帮助你快速上手。
一、MVC框架概述
MVC是一种软件设计模式,它将应用程序分为三个核心部分:模型(Model)、视图(View)和控制器(Controller)。
- 模型(Model):负责处理应用程序的数据逻辑,如数据库操作、业务逻辑等。
- 视图(View):负责展示数据,如HTML页面、JSON数据等。
- 控制器(Controller):负责接收用户输入,调用模型和视图,响应用户请求。
这种模式使得应用程序的各个部分相互独立,便于开发、测试和维护。
二、MVC框架入门教程
1. MVC基本概念
首先,你需要了解MVC的基本概念,包括模型、视图和控制器的作用以及它们之间的关系。
2. 选择合适的MVC框架
目前,市面上有许多MVC框架可供选择,如Ruby on Rails、Django、Spring MVC等。根据你的项目需求和开发语言,选择一个合适的框架至关重要。
3. 学习框架API
熟悉你选择的MVC框架的API,包括模型、视图和控制器等组件的使用方法。
4. 编写第一个MVC应用程序
通过一个简单的示例,学习如何使用MVC框架开发应用程序。
三、实战资源汇总
以下是一些MVC框架的实战资源,帮助你快速上手:
1. Ruby on Rails
- 官方文档:Ruby on Rails 官方文档
- 教程:Ruby on Rails 教程
2. Django
- 官方文档:Django 官方文档
- 教程:Django 教程
3. Spring MVC
- 官方文档:Spring MVC 官方文档
- 教程:Spring MVC 教程
4. Laravel
- 官方文档:Laravel 官方文档
- 教程:Laravel 教程
四、总结
MVC框架在电商网站开发中具有广泛的应用。通过本文的介绍,相信你已经对MVC框架有了初步的了解。希望你能结合实战资源,深入学习MVC框架,为你的电商网站开发之路打下坚实的基础。
